Logiq has achieved ISO 14001 certification for the first time and successfully renewed its ISO 9001 certification, marking a further step in the development of the company’s management systems.
ISO 14001 is the internationally recognised standard for environmental management systems. It provides a framework for organisations to identify and manage their environmental impacts, meet applicable environmental obligations and improve environmental performance over time.

Achieving certification follows the introduction and assessment of Logiq’s environmental management system, providing a structured approach to managing environmental responsibilities across the business. This includes understanding the environmental impact of its activities, setting objectives and maintaining processes to support continual improvement.
The new certification comes alongside the successful renewal of Logiq’s ISO 9001 certification following its latest assessment. ISO 9001 is the internationally recognised standard for quality management systems, providing a framework for maintaining consistent processes, monitoring performance and continually improving the way an organisation operates.
For clients, partners and organisations assessing Logiq as part of procurement and supplier assurance processes, the certifications provide independently assessed evidence of the management systems in place across the business. This is particularly relevant across defence, government and other regulated sectors, where suppliers may be required to demonstrate established approaches to quality, governance and environmental management.
ISO 14001 joins Logiq’s existing certifications for quality management, information security management and IT service management. Alongside ISO 9001, Logiq also holds ISO/IEC 27001 and ISO/IEC 20000-1 certification.
Together, these standards support the governance and management systems behind Logiq’s day-to-day operations and its work with clients. As the company continues to grow, they provide established frameworks for maintaining consistency, managing risk and supporting continual improvement.
